Programmation 1 SMI3
Un algorithme est une séquence d’opérations visant à la résolution
d’un problème en un temps fini. La conception d’un algorithme se
fait par étapes de plus en plus détaillées. La traduction de l’algorithme en un langage informatique et on
obtient un programme qui est défini comme une suite d’instructions
permettant de réaliser une ou plusieurs taches, de résoudre un
problème, de manipuler des données. Le langage de base compréhensible par un ordinateur, appelé
langage machine est constitué d’une suite de 0 et de 1. Plusieurs langages de programmation : structurelle (C, Pascal, …),
fonctionnelle (Lisp,…), logique (Prolog, …), scientifique (Maple,
Matlab,…), objet (C++, Java, …) . En 1972, Ritchie a conçu le langage C pour développer une version
portable du système d’exploitation UNIX. En 1978, le duo Ritchie / Kernighan a publié la définition classique
du langage C dans le livre « The C programming language », Dans les années 80, le langage C est devenu de plus en plus
populaire que ce soit dans le monde académique que celui des
professionnels (C avec des extensions particuliers) . En 1983, l’organisme ANSI chargeait une commission de mettre
au point une définition explicite et indépendante de la machine
pour le langage C définition de la norme ANSI-C en 1989.
Cours:
-------------------------------------------------------------------
Télécharger PDF 1: Cours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 2: Cours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 3: Cours Programmation 1 SMI3 : ICI -------------------------------------------------------------------
TD:
-------------------------------------------------------------------
Télécharger PDF 1: TD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 2: TD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 3: TD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 4: TD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 5: TD Programmation 1 SMI3 : ICI
------------------------------------------------------------------- Télécharger PDF 6: TD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 7: TD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 8: TD Programmation 1 SMI3 : ICI-------------------------------------------------------------------
Examen:
-------------------------------------------------------------------
Télécharger PDF 1: Examen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 2: Examen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 3: Examen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 4: Examen Programmation 1 SMI3 : ICI -------------------------------------------------------------------
Télécharger PDF 5: Examen Programmation 1 SMI3 : ICI
------------------------------------------------------------------- Télécharger PDF 6: Examen Programmation 1 SMI3 : ICI -------------------------------------------------------------------